How to Talk to your CIO

• Focus ono Decisionso Resultso Key thought points – “knowing your stuff”

• Toss outo The process you are going through

• Holding Meetings, Analyzing Stuffo Information that requires explanation

• “40% of our servers use tape backup today”o Details because you think someone would want to know

• “Included are 10 pages of appendix that you can read later”
